    New to Canton, Spice Art brings Indian cuisine to the town center. LOCATION: Located on the busy Main Street, Spice Art is in a tiny space with a few tables available. Street parking only. This is more of a grab and go place rather than a sit down. MENU: A lot of typical offerings from chicken tikka to Biranyi to Mango Lassi. FOOD: I ordered the mild chicken tikka masala and it came out sweeter than usual. It's a little different than others I've had before and I wasn't a fan of it - I needed a little more spice. The garlic naan was delicious though! SERVICE: I think they are still working things out but overall everyone was friendly.

    Spice Art is a very new, nice little restaurant on Washington street in Canton. Today at their location I ate delicious tandoori chicken, garlic naan bread, basmati rice, and a side of chicken tikka masala. I also drank a mango lassi which hit the spot. This restaurant is owned by a lovely family who is very friendly and will make you feel welcomed. I recommend coming here for a eat in lunch or takeout when craving authentic Indian food.
